Genus: Hypserpa

Name

Hypserpa Miers, Ann. Mag. Nat. Hist., ser. 2, 7(37): 36, 40. 1851.

Synonymy

Overview of species

Accepted species

H. ademae  H. calcicola  H. decumbens  H. laurina  H. mackeei  H. neocaledonica  H. nitida  H. polyandra  H. smilacifolia  H. vieillardii
Paleospecies: †H. cashmamensis H. franklinensis

Source(s) of checklist:
List based on accepted species according to Forman (1997), Takeuchi (2008), and Wolfe (1968) – see references.
